A software engineer is a professional who applies engineering principles to the design, development, maintenance, testing, and evaluation of software and systems. The roles and responsibilities of software engineers can vary significantly based on their level of experience and expertise, often categorized into levels such as Software Engineer 1, 2, 3, and 4. Understanding these levels can help you navigate a career in software engineering or hire the right talent for your team.
What Are Software Engineer Levels 1, 2, 3, and 4?
Software Engineer 1 (Entry-Level)
Software Engineer 1, often referred to as a junior software engineer, typically includes recent graduates or those new to the field. They focus on learning and applying foundational skills.
-
Responsibilities:
- Writing simple code under supervision
- Assisting in debugging and testing
- Collaborating with team members on projects
-
Skills Required:
- Basic programming knowledge
- Understanding of software development lifecycle
- Ability to follow instructions and learn from feedback
-
Example: A junior engineer might work on a small feature of a larger project, such as developing a login page for a web application.
Software Engineer 2 (Mid-Level)
Software Engineer 2 is a mid-level position where individuals have gained some experience and can handle more complex tasks with less supervision.
-
Responsibilities:
- Developing and implementing new features
- Writing and maintaining code with minimal guidance
- Participating in code reviews and testing
-
Skills Required:
- Proficiency in one or more programming languages
- Problem-solving and analytical skills
- Ability to work independently and in teams
-
Example: A mid-level engineer might be responsible for designing and developing a new module for an existing software application.
Software Engineer 3 (Senior-Level)
Software Engineer 3 represents a senior-level position, requiring significant experience and expertise. These engineers often take on leadership roles within projects.
-
Responsibilities:
- Leading project design and architecture
- Mentoring junior engineers
- Ensuring quality and performance of software solutions
-
Skills Required:
- Advanced programming and design skills
- Strong leadership and communication abilities
- Experience in project management and system architecture
-
Example: A senior engineer could lead the development of a new software product, overseeing the entire development process from conception to deployment.
Software Engineer 4 (Lead/Principal-Level)
Software Engineer 4, often seen as a lead or principal engineer, involves strategic oversight and high-level decision-making.
-
Responsibilities:
- Defining technical strategy and vision
- Leading cross-functional teams
- Driving innovation and process improvements
-
Skills Required:
- Expertise in multiple technologies and frameworks
- Exceptional leadership and strategic thinking
- Extensive experience in software architecture and design
-
Example: A lead engineer might spearhead the development of a company’s new flagship product, integrating cutting-edge technologies.
Comparison of Software Engineer Levels
| Feature | Software Engineer 1 | Software Engineer 2 | Software Engineer 3 | Software Engineer 4 |
|---|---|---|---|---|
| Experience | Entry-level | Mid-level | Senior-level | Lead-level |
| Supervision | High | Moderate | Low | Minimal |
| Leadership | None | Some | High | Extensive |
| Technical Skills | Basic | Intermediate | Advanced | Expert |
How to Advance Through Software Engineer Levels
- Continuous Learning: Stay updated with the latest technologies and programming languages.
- Networking: Connect with industry professionals and participate in tech communities.
- Project Involvement: Seek opportunities to lead projects and take on more responsibilities.
- Mentorship: Learn from experienced engineers and, in turn, mentor others.

What is the difference between a software engineer and a developer?
A software engineer applies engineering principles to software creation, focusing on the entire system and its architecture. A developer typically focuses on building applications and writing code, often working on specific tasks within the software development process.
How long does it take to become a senior software engineer?
Becoming a senior software engineer typically takes around 5-10 years, depending on individual career paths, skill development, and opportunities for advancement.
What skills are essential for a software engineer?
Essential skills for a software engineer include programming proficiency, problem-solving, teamwork, communication, and an understanding of software development methodologies.
Can a software engineer work remotely?
Yes, many software engineers work remotely, especially given the rise of digital collaboration tools and platforms. Remote work is common in tech companies and startups.
What is the average salary for a software engineer?
The average salary for a software engineer varies based on location, experience, and company size. In the United States, it typically ranges from $70,000 to over $150,000 annually.
